Popular Android Package Uses Just XOR — and That’s Not the Worst Part

siddesu writes A popular ‘encryption’ package for Android that even charges a yearly subscription fee of $8, actually does nothing more than give false sense of security to its users. Not only is the app using a worthless encryption method, it also uses weak keys and ‘encrypts’ only a small portion of the files. Intel Launches SSD 750 Series Consumer NVMe PCI Express SSD At Under $1 Per GiB

MojoKid writes Today, Intel took the wraps off new NVMe PCI Express Solid State Drives, which are the first products with these high speed interfaces, that the company has launched specifically for the enthusiast computing and workstation market. Historically, Intel’s PCI Express-based offerings, like the SSD DC P3700 Series, have been targeted for datacenter or enterprise applications, with price tags to match. However, the Intel SSD 750 Series PCI Express SSD, though based on the same custom NVMe controller technology as the company’s expensive P3700 drive, will drop in at less than a dollar per GiB, while offering performance almost on par with its enterprise-class sibling. Available in 400GB and 1.2TB capacities, the Intel SSD 750 is able to hit peak read and write bandwidth numbers of 2.4GB/sec and 1.2GB/sec, respectively. In the benchmarks, it takes many of the top PCIe SSD cards to task easily and at $389 for a 400GB model, you won’t have to sell an organ to afford one. Read more of this story at Slashdot.

California Has Become the First State To Get Over 5% of Its Power From Solar

Lucas123 writes: While the rest of the nation’s solar power generation hovers around 1%, California clocked in with a record 5% of power coming from utility-grade (1MW or more) solar power sources, according to a report from Mercom Capital Group and the Energy Information Administration. That’s three times the next closest state, Arizona. At the same time, 22 states have yet to deploy even one utility-grade solar power plant, according to the Solar Energy Industry Association. Meanwhile, the rest of the world saw a 14% uptick in solar power installations in 2014 for a total of 54.5GW of capacity, and that figure is expected to grow even faster in 2015. While China still leads the world in new solar capacity, Japan and the U.S. come in as a close second and third, respectively. In the U.S. distributed solar and utility-grade solar installations are soaring as the solar investment tax credit (ITC) is set to expire next year. The U.S. is expected to deploy 8.5GW of new solar capacity in 2015, according to Mercom Capital Group. Read more of this story at Slashdot.

First look at Project Spartan, Microsoft’s take on the modern browser

When announcing that a Windows 10 Preview with the new Project Spartan browser was available , Microsoft made clear that the browser ain’t done yet. What we have now is an early iteration of the company’s take on a legacy-free forward-looking browser—a browser that’s going to ditch the venerable Internet Explorer name. Superficially, everything about the browser is new. Its interface takes cues from all the competition: tabs on top, in the title bar, the address bar inside each tab. The look is simple and unadorned; monochrome line-art for icons, rectangular tabs, and a flat look—the address bar, for example, doesn’t live in a recessed pit (as it does in Chrome) and is integral with the toolbar (unlike Internet Explorer). The design concept works well for me, though I doubt this will be universal. As is so often the case on Windows, it doesn’t really fit with the rest of the operating system. While parts of Windows 10 have a similar appearance—most notably the Settings app—Windows overall remains an inconsistent mish-mash of looks and feels, to its detriment. How Malvertising Abuses Real-Time Bidding On Ad Networks

msm1267 writes Dark corners of the Internet harbor trouble. They’re supposed to. But what about when Yahoo, CNN.com, TMZ and other busy destination sites heave disaster upon visitors? That’s the challenge posed by malvertising, the latest hacker Golden Goose used in cybercrime operations and even in some targeted attacks. Hackers are thriving in this arena because they have found an unwittingly complicit partner in the sundry ad networks to move malicious ads through legitimate processes. Adding gasoline to the raging fire is the abuse of real-time ad bidding, a revolution in the way online ads are sold. RTB enables better ad targeting for advertisers and less unsold inventory for publishers. Hackers can also hitch a ride with RTB and target malicious ads on any site they wish, much the way a legitimate advertiser would use the same system. Read more of this story at Slashdot.

Material Made From Crustaceans Could Combat Battlefield Blood Loss

MTorrice writes: A foam composed of a polymer derived from crustacean shells may prevent more soldiers from falling victim to the most prolific killer on the battlefield: blood loss. Pressure is one of the best tools that medics have to fight bleeding, but they can’t use it on severe wounds near organs. Here, compression could do more harm than good. First responders have no way to effectively dam blood flows from these non-compressible injuries, which account for the majority of hemorrhagic deaths. The new foam could help stop bleeding in these types of injuries. It relies on chitosan, a biopolymer that comes from processed crustacean shells. By modifying the chitosan, the developers gave the material the ability to anchor blood cells into gel-like networks, essentially forming blood clots. The researchers dispersed the modified chitosan in water to create a fluid they could spray directly onto noncompressible wounds. Read more of this story at Slashdot.

Graphene Light Bulbs Coming To Stores Soon

An anonymous reader writes: A light bulb made from graphene — said by its UK developers to be the first commercially viable consumer product using the super-strong carbon — is to go on sale later this year. The dimmable LED bulb with a graphene-coated filament was designed at Manchester University, where the material was discovered in 2004. It is said to cut energy use by 10% and last longer owing to its conductivity. It is expected to be priced lower than current LED bulbs, which cost about £15 (~$22) each. Measuring How Much "Standby Mode" Electricity For Game Consoles Will Cost You

An anonymous reader writes: Modern game consoles have a “standby” mode, which you can use if you want the console to instantly turn on while not drawing full power the whole time it’s idle. But manufacturers are vague about how much power it takes to keep the consoles in this standby state. After a recent press release claiming $250 million worth of electricity was used to power Xbox Ones in standby mode in the past year, Ars Technica decided to run some tests to figure out exactly how much power is being drawn. Their conclusions: the PS4 draws about 10 Watts, $10-11 in extra electricity charges annually. The Xbox One draws 12.9W, costing users $13-$14 in extra electricity charges annually. The Wii U draws 13.3W, costing users $14-$15 in extra electricity charges annually. These aren’t trivial amounts, but they’re a lot less than simply leaving the console running and shutting off the TV when you aren’t using it: “Leaving your PS4 sitting on the menu like this all year would waste over $142 in electricity costs.” Read more of this story at Slashdot.
